дан массив целых чисел. отсортировать по убыванию элементы расположенные между k-м и s-м элементами (т.е. с (k+1)-го по (s-1)-й) значения k и s вводятся с клавиатуры.
Чтобы ответить на данный вопрос, нужно учесть некоторые особенности операторов поисковых запросов.
В данном случае, каждый запрос содержит название страны и количество найденных страниц по данному запросу.
Запрос "Франция 450" означает, что при поиске по слову "Франция" было найдено 450 страниц.
Запрос "Италия 320" означает, что при поиске по слову "Италия" было найдено 320 страниц.
Запрос "Франция & Италия 80" означает, что при одновременном поиске по словам "Франция" и "Италия" было найдено 80 страниц.
Теперь рассмотрим запрос "Франция | Италия". Знак | (вертикальная черта) в поисковых системах означает оператор "ИЛИ", то есть поиск страниц, которые содержат хотя бы одно из указанных слов.
Для решения данной задачи нужно сложить количество страниц, найденных по запросу "Франция" и количество страниц, найденных по запросу "Италия", и исключить повторяющиеся страницы (которые были найдены при одновременном поиске по обоим словам).
Обозначим количество страниц, найденных по запросу "Франция" как F (450), количество страниц, найденных по запросу "Италия" как I (320) и количество страниц, найденных при одновременном поиске по обоим словам как F & I (80).
Чтобы найти количество страниц, найденных по запросу "Франция | Италия", нужно суммировать F и I, и вычесть F & I. Математически это можно записать как (F + I) - (F & I).
Теперь подставим известные значения в формулу:
(450 + 320) - 80 = 770 - 80 = 690
Таким образом, по запросу "Франция | Италия" поисковый сервер найдет 690 страниц.
Обоснование: Мы использовали оператор "ИЛИ", поэтому нужно учесть все страницы, которые содержат хотя бы одно из указанных слов. При этом исключаем повторяющиеся страницы, которые были найдены при одновременном поиске по обоим словам.
Это пошаговое решение поможет школьнику лучше понять, как получить правильный ответ.
Добрый день! Давайте разберем ваш вопрос по пунктам:
1. Во многих языках программирования можно использовать массивы символов и строки. Отличие между строкой и массивом символов заключается в их представлении и обработке.
Массив символов представляет собой коллекцию символов, где каждый элемент массива является отдельным символом. Например, массив символов ['H', 'e', 'l', 'l', 'o'] представляет слово "Hello". Каждый символ имеет свой индекс в массиве, начиная с 0.
Строка же - это последовательность символов, объединенных в одну структуру данных, которая обычно представляется между двойными кавычками или одинарными кавычками, в зависимости от выбранного языка программирования. Например, "Hello" или 'Hello'. Строка может содержать как один символ, так и несколько.
2. Оператор + работает по-разному для чисел и символьных строк.
Для чисел оператор + используется для выполнения арифметической операции сложения. Например, 2 + 3 = 5.
Для символьных строк оператор + используется для операции конкатенации, то есть объединения двух строк в одну. Например, "Hello" + " world" = "Hello world".
3. Можно обойтись без стандартной функции для вставки подстроки, используя методы и функции для работы со строками, которые предоставляет язык программирования. Например, в большинстве языков программирования есть метод replace(), который заменяет все вхождения подстроки на другую строку. Таким образом, мы можем заменить вставку подстроки с использованием этого метода.
4. Для определения, что при поиске в строке образец не найден, мы можем использовать функцию или метод поиска, предоставленный языком программирования. Например, функция find() может возвращать индекс первого вхождения указанной подстроки в строке. Если find() вернул -1, это означает, что образец не найден в строке.
5. Для поиска первого символа "с" с конца строки мы можем использовать метод или функцию обратного поиска, предоставленную языком программирования. Например, метод rfind() возвращает индекс последнего вхождения указанного символа или подстроки в строке.
Надеюсь, данное объяснение помогло вам понять вопросы по информатике.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ota
Оформи подписку